#c91095 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c91095 is composed of 78.8% red, 6.3%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92% magenta, 25.9%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 316.9 degrees, a saturation of 85.3% and a lightness of 42.5%. #c91095 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ff20ff with #93002b.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

#c91095 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c91095 has RGB values of R:201, G:16,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.92, Y:0.26,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 13176981.
